EC Number | Activating Compound | Comment | Organism | Structure |
---|---|---|---|---|
1.11.1.21 | ammonium sulfate | additions of ammonium sulfate even at weak concentrations (10 to 70 mM) stimulate catalatic activity measured in the presence of 1.5 M NaC1 by about 30% | Haloarcula marismortui | |
1.11.1.21 | NaCl | with NaC1, maximum activity is observed near 0.5-0.7 M | Haloarcula marismortui |
EC Number | Inhibitors | Comment | Organism | Structure |
---|---|---|---|---|
1.11.1.21 | additional information | no inhibition of the catalase activity of hCP is seen with 3-amino-l,2,4-triazole | Haloarcula marismortui | |
1.11.1.21 | NaCl | the peroxidatic activity on diaminobenzidine shows a continuous decrease with increasing NaCl concentration | Haloarcula marismortui |
